Számítógépes Hálózatok 6. gyakorlat
Központi zárthelyi Időpont: , Kedd, 8:30-9:45 Helyszín: Konferencia terem (É ) Számonkérés módja: írásbeli (elméleti és gyakorlati kérdések vegyesen) Főbb gyakorlati témakörök: késleletetés és adatátvitellel kapcsolatos számítások, CRC számítás, TCP torlódás védelmi algoritmusok hatékonysága és fairsége, útvonal számítási algoritmusok. Gombos Gergő Számítógépes hálózatok GY2
Késleletetés és adatátvitel 1. F ELADAT Egy küldő egy üvegszál kábelen egy fényszignált küld PS teljesítménnyel. Tegyük fel, hogy a fogadónál ennek a szignálnak legalább PS/1000 teljesítménnyel kell megérkezni ahhoz, hogy fel tudja ismerni. A kábelben a szignál teljesítményének csökkenése kilométerenként 8%. Milyen hosszú lehet a kábel? 2. F ELADAT Egy felsőbb réteg csomagját az adatkapcsolati réteg 5 darab keretre bontja. Minden keret 65% eséllyel érkezik meg a másik oldalra hibamentesen (pl. ilyen lehet egy zajos WiFi környezet). Tegyük fel, hogy az adatkapcsolati réteg nem tartalmaz hibakezelést, azaz ha az 5 darab keret egyike megsérül, akkor a felsőbb rétegnek a teljes csomagot újra kell küldenie. Adja meg, hogy várhatóan hányszor kell a felsőbb rétegnek újraküldeni a csomagot ahhoz, hogy az hibamentesen megérkezzen a másik oldalra! Gombos Gergő Számítógépes hálózatok GY3
Késleletetés és adatátvitel 1. Feladat Kezdeti teljesítmény: PS, km-ként 8% csökken, tehát: PS * 0,92 l >= PS / ,92 l >= 1/1000 ln 0,92 l >= ln 0,001 l * ln 0,92 > ln 0,001 l <= ln 0,001 / ln 0,92 = 82,85 km 2. Feladat P siker = (0.65) 5 E(X) = 1/(p siker ) = (geometriai eloszlás) Gombos Gergő Számítógépes hálózatok GY4
CRC 1. F ELADAT Történt-e hiba az átvitel során, ha a vevő a következő üzenetet kapja és a generátor polinom x 4 +x 2 +1 ? 2. F ELADAT Számolja ki a CRC kontrollösszeget az üzenetre, ha a generátor polinom x 4 +x 3 +x 2 +1 ! Mutasson példát olyan bit-hibára, amit nem képes felismerni a fenti módszer! Gombos Gergő Számítógépes hálózatok GY5
CRC 1. F ELADAT r(x)=1000 <> 0 azaz történt hiba 2. F ELADAT r(x)=0100 (3 pont) T(X)~~ (1 pont) E(X)~~ (1 pont) Gombos Gergő Számítógépes hálózatok GY6
Útvonal számítási algoritmusok Gombos Gergő Számítógépes hálózatok GY7
Kapcsolatállapot dpredd d d d d A∞-∞-∞-∞-6E6E B∞-∞-∞-11C6E6E C∞-3F3F3F3F3F D∞-2F2F2F2F2F E∞-7F5D5D5D5D F Számítógépes hálózatok GY8 Gombos Gergő A E D CB F
Hatékonyság és fairness Gombos Gergő Számítógépes hálózatok GY9
Hatékonyság, fairness tx 1 (t)x 2 (t)X(t)F(x) 01450, , , , , , , , ,96 Számítógépes hálózatok GY10 Gombos Gergő
Vége